ВходНаше всё Теги codebook 无线电组件 Поиск Опросы Закон Среда
27 ноября
125510
rezident (17.07.2008 16:02, просмотров: 14909)
Ответ на сообщение cvv про SPI. http://caxapa.ru/125483.html
В очередной раз напоминаю, что SPI это синхронный интерфейс предназначенный для обмена данными. Чтобы что-то принять нужно что-то передать. Так что ответ слейва на текущую команду мастера, переданную по SPI, можно получить только следующим байтом транзакции. Учитывайте этот факт при разработке вашего протокола связи. Ну и не гонитесь за слишком высокими скоростями. Реакция слейва ведь не мгновенная. Если необходимо, то используйте программную буферизацию обмена и "посадите" его (обмен) на прерывание от SPI.